Description
The Sketcher CreatePeriodicBSpline tool creates a periodic (closed) B-spline curve from control points. See this page for more information about B-splines.
Usage
See also: Drawing aids.
- There are several ways to invoke the tool:
- Press the Periodic B-spline by control points button.
- Select the Sketcher → Sketcher geometries → Create periodic B-spline option from the menu.
- Use the keyboard shortcut: G then B, then P.
- For further steps see Sketcher CreateBSpline.
